IV-236 pages demi-chagrin havane, dos à faux nerfs 1836, 1836, in-4, IV-236 pages, demi-chagrin havane, dos à faux nerfs, Première édition séparée. Important ouvrage dans lequel Cauchy (1789-1867), à la suite de Fresnel, explique la dispersion de la lumière selon la théorie ondulatoire. Il a paru à l'origine en 8 livraisons dans les Nouveaux exercices de mathématiques en 1835; il s'inscrit dans la continuité ses travaux précédents, publiés à Paris en 1830. Ce mémoire a paru quant à lui à Prague, où le mathématicien était précepteur du duc de Bordeaux en exil. Titre et avant-propos des Nouveaux exercices de 1835 rajoutés parmi les feuillets liminaires.
